Curve Release 2012 Schedule Highlighted by April 5 Opener and July 4th Home Games

CURVE, Pa. - The Altoona Curve will open their 2012 season at Blair County Ballpark, once again host a game on July 4, and be home for 30 games in July and August, the team announced today when releasing its schedule for next season.

The Curve's 14th season of Eastern League baseball will begin on Thursday, April 5 against the Erie SeaWolves at Blair County Ballpark. Altoona is scheduled to play 13 home games in April, 15 in May, 13 in June and 15 each in July and August while having no home dates in the month of September. The club will once again spend the Fourth of July in Curve, Pa. as they'll face the Reading Phillies at home.

Game times for the 2012 season have been slightly tweaked in the months of April and May. While the standard game times for contests Monday-Friday will remain at 6:30 p.m. in the first two months, the weekend times have been adjusted. Saturdays in April and May will have scheduled start times of 6 p.m. (a half-hour later than 2011), while Sunday games will begin at 1 p.m. (an hour earlier than this season). The exception will be Sunday, May 20 which has a scheduled first pitch of 6 p.m.

Standard June-August game times will remain 7 p.m. for Monday-Saturday games and 6 p.m. on Sunday. The Curve will host four weekday day games during the 2012 season. There will be three Education Days with 10:30 a.m. game times: May 9, 23, and 24. Monday, July 9 will be the annual Super Splash Day game at 12 p.m.

"We're really pleased with our schedule for 2012," said Curve General Manager Rob Egan. "To open the season at Blair County Ballpark, once again host a game on July 4th, and have 15 home dates in both July and August will give our fans plenty of great dates to choose from next year."

Fans of the New York Yankees will get to see the Trenton Thunder at two different points in 2012 with the first series coming June 12-14. The two clubs will play three more times in Altoona: August 10-12.

Red Sox fans will get their taste of the Portland Sea Dogs June 1-3 in Curve, Pa. Those that wish to see the Harrisburg Senators and some of the top prospects in the Nationals' organization will have an opportunity to do so as the Curve have seven home dates with the Senators early in the season.
